Established on 15th Mangshir 2048 B.S. (1st December 1991 A.D.), Chaitanya Multiple Campus (CMC) is a community-based public institution located in Banepa, Kavrepalanchok, Nepal. Affiliated with Tribhuvan University (TU) and the National Examinations Board (NEB), CMC was founded by a group of dedicated teachers, educationists, and social workers. The campus emerged in response to the growing need for higher education in the region, particularly following Nepal's democratic movement in 1990.
It is affiliated with Tribhuban University (T.U.) and the National Examinations Board (NEB). CMC offers various courses such as Bachelor of Business Studies (BBS), Bachelor of Education (B.Ed.), M.Ed. Education Planning and Management, M.Ed. English Language Education, M.Ed. Nepali Language Education, Master of Education (M.Ed.) in Mathematics Education, and 10+2 programs in Education and Management.
CMC is a non-profit, service-oriented academic institution dedicated to providing affordable and accessible education to students from diverse backgrounds, including those from remote and underprivileged areas such as Ramechhap, Sindhupalchok, Sindhuli, and other nearby districts.

First campus in Kavre district to initiate M.Ed. programs in EPM, English, Nepali, and Mathematics since 2062 Poush
Over 25 years of continuous service in public education
Recognized by the University Grants Commission (UGC) Nepal for regular grants
Contributions toward higher education in rural and marginalized regions
